Has Justin Kodua Disqualified Hon. Kwasi Bonzoh?

Over the past week, tensions have been rising within the New Patriotic Party in the Western Region following allegations that the General Secretary, Mr. Justin Kodua Frimpong, may be behind the disqualification of Hon. Kwasi Bonzoh from contesting for the position of Regional Secretary.
These concerns have gained momentum because Hon. Bonzoh is widely regarded as a strong candidate with a realistic chance of defeating the incumbent Regional Secretary, who is perceived by some party members as the preferred candidate of the General Secretary.
For more than twenty years, Hon. Kwasi Bonzoh has served the New Patriotic Party with loyalty, dedication and sacrifice. He served as the NPP Parliamentary Candidate for Ellembelle for sixteen years and later served as District Chief Executive for Ellembelle for eight years under the Akufo-Addo administration. His commitment to the party and contribution to its development cannot reasonably be questioned.
Despite presenting his academic credentials and supporting documents to the Regional Appeals Committee, his disqualification was upheld. This has left many loyal party members asking an important question: why is Hon. Kwasi Bonzoh being denied the opportunity to contest?
Believing in the principles of fairness, justice and internal democracy that have always guided the New Patriotic Party, Hon. Bonzoh has appealed the decision to the National Steering Committee.
His appeal has been submitted to:
Mr. Smith Danquah, Acting National Chairman
Dr. Mahamudu Bawumia, Presidential Candidate
Alexander Kwamina Afenyo-Markin, Majority Leader
Mr. Justin Kodua Frimpong, General Secretary
Hon. Kwasi Bonzoh remains confident that justice will prevail and that every qualified and committed party member will be given a fair opportunity to serve.
